What caused the asteroid belt?

Origin. Early in the life of the solar system, dust and rock circling the sun were pulled together by gravity into planets. But not all of the ingredients created new worlds. A region between Mars and Jupiter became the asteroid belt.May 4, 2017

Is the asteroid belt a destroyed planet?

Most astronomers today believe that the asteroids in the main belt are remnants of the protoplanetary disk that never formed a planet, and that in this region the amalgamation of protoplanets into a planet was prevented by the disruptive gravitational perturbations of Jupiter during the formative period of the Solar …

What is the purpose of asteroid belt?

The asteroid belt (sometimes referred to as the main asteroid belt) orbits between Mars and Jupiter. It consists of asteroids and minor planets forming a disk around the sun. It also serves as a sort of dividing line between the inner rocky planets and outer gas giants.

What keeps the asteroid belt in place?

They may have never formed a very small planet because of the gravitational pull from of Jupiter (very strong) and Mars (very weak). The pulling of the two planets keeps the asteroids separated and circling the Sun in a doughnut shaped area.

What could cause asteroids to leave the asteroid belt?

If an asteroid is captured by the gravitational pull of a planet, the asteroid can be pulled out of the belt and go into orbit as a moon around the planet that pulled on it.

What keeps most asteroids in the asteroid belt?

Gravity keeps the asteroids in orbit around the sun, but the main asteroid belt we see today is only a tiny fraction of what used to exist and is predominately empty space.

Do asteroids hit the Sun?

No asteroids have ever been observed to hit the Sun, but that doesn't mean that they don't! Asteroids are normally content to stay in the asteroid belt between Mars and Jupiter, but occasionally something nudges them out of their original orbits, and they come careening into the inner solar system.
